Discover what phones are compatible with your Samsung smartwatch
Before setting up your Samsung smartwatch, make sure your smartphone is compatible. Samsung smartwatches work with Samsung Galaxy devices and select Android and iOS devices, although available features may vary depending on your phone model and operating system. Review the compatibility information below to confirm that your phone can connect to your Samsung watch.
Note: The information provided here is specific to devices sold in Canada. Compatibility of your device may vary based on your region, carrier, or model specifications.
Being a Samsung product, Samsung Galaxy devices offer extensive compatibility options. Ensure you've downloaded the Galaxy Wearable app from the Play Store and that your device is updated to the latest software version.
- Galaxy Watch8 and Galaxy Watch8 Classic: Compatible with phones running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ch7: Compatible with phones running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ch Ultra: Compatible with phones running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ch FE: Compatible with phones running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ch6 and Galaxy Watch6 Classic: Compatible with phones running Android 10.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ch5 and Galaxy Watch5 Pro: Compatible with phones running Android 8.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ch4 and Galaxy Watch4 Classic: Compatible with phones running Android 6.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ch and Galaxy Watch3: Compatible with phones running Android 5.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ch Active and Galaxy Watch Active2: Compatible with phones running Android 5.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Gear Sport, Gear S2 Classic, Gear S3 Frontier, Gear S3 Classic, Gear Fit2, and Gear Fit2 Pro: Compatible with phones running Android 4.3 through Android 13 and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M. Consequently, these models are not compatible with Samsung Galaxy phones that operate on Android 14 or newer, including the Galaxy S26 series, Galaxy A25 and Galaxy A15.

Non-Samsung phones or tablets running Android can also connect to Galaxy Watches and Gear devices. For optimal results, ensure your device is updated to the latest software version and install the Galaxy Wearable app from the Play Store.
- Galaxy Watch8 and Galaxy Watch8 Classic: Supported on phones with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ch7: Supported on phones with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ch Ultra: Supported on phones with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ch FE: Supported on phones with Android 11.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ch6 and Galaxy Watch6 Classic: Supported on phones with Android 10.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ch5 and Galaxy Watch5 Pro: Supported on phones with Android 8.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ch4 and Galaxy Watch4 Classic: Supported on phones with Android 6.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ch and Galaxy Watch3: Supported on phones with Android 5.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Galaxy Watch Active and Galaxy Watch Active2: Supported on phones with Android 5.0 or higher and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M.
- Gear Sport, Gear S2 Classic, Gear S3 Frontier, Gear S3 Classic, Gear Fit2, Gear Fit2 Pro: Supported on phones with Android 4.3 through Android 13 and equipped with at least 1.5 GB of RAM. Consequently, these models are not compatible with Samsung Galaxy phones that operate on Android 14 or newer, including the Galaxy S24 series, Galaxy A25, and Galaxy A15.
- Gear, Gear 2, Gear S, and Gear Fit: These devices are not supported on non-Samsung Android phones.
Note:
- When connected with non-Samsung mobile devices, some features specific to each manufacturer may have limited support. Additionally, certain functionalities, such as Samsung Wallet, are exclusively available on Samsung phones.
- Supported devices may vary depending on your region, operator, and device brand.
Don't worry if you're an iPhone user. Many models are compatible and can seamlessly connect to a Galaxy Watch or Gear device. For optimal compatibility, ensure your iPhone's iOS is updated to the latest version. Download the Galaxy Wearable app for your device from the App Store.
Compatibles devices
- Galaxy Watch, Galaxy Watch Active, and Galaxy Watch Active2: Compatible with iPhones (iPhone 5 or later) running iOS 9 and above.
- Gear Live, Gear S2, Gear Fit2, Gear S3, Gear Sport, and Gear Fit2 Pro: Compatible with iPhones (iPhone 5 or later) running iOS 9 and above.
- Galaxy Fit: Compatible with iPhone 7 or later running iOS 10 and above.
Incompatible devices
- Galaxy Watch4 series, Galaxy Watch5 series, Galaxy Watch6 series, Galaxy Watch FE, Galaxy Watch Ultra, Galaxy Watch7 and Galaxy Watch8 series: These watches rely on Google Play services, which are not supported on iOS.
- Gear, Gear 2, Gear S, and Gear Fit: These devices are not supported on iOS.
Note:
- iPad and iPod touch are not supported.
- For iPhone 6S and 6S+ running iOS 10 and later, the connection may be unstable.
